simplicity-review
Analystes en assurance qualité des logiciels et testeurs

Review a change for over-engineering and bloat — speculative generality, gold-plating, dead code, needless indirection, premature optimization, wrong abstractions — and propose the simplest version that still meets the spec and passes the tests. Use before opening a PR, and when auditing an AI-generated diff that feels larger than the problem. The mirror of meaningful-test-coverage: that fights too little verification, this fights too much code.

meaningful-test-coverage
Analystes en assurance qualité des logiciels et testeurs

Author thorough, no-theater tests across every layer a change touches — via a multi-agent workflow that designs the RIGHT-level test per layer, adversarially verifies each for test theater / over-mocking, then implements and runs the survivors. Use after a substantive multi-layer change (data/schema + query + service + frontend) when you want coverage that actually catches the bug, not green-theater. Enforces the inversion test and level-correctness (data/query → integration, pure logic → unit, rendering → component, story → E2E).

openelis-test-catalog-qa
Analystes en assurance qualité des logiciels et testeurs

Automated QA testing skill for OpenELIS Global — drives a live instance to execute test suites and produce a maturity-rated pass/fail report with Jira tickets. Broad coverage (100+ suites across Orders, Validation, Results, Patient, Dashboard, Admin pages, all Reports, Referrals, Workplan, FHIR, i18n, Accessibility, Pathology, Analyzers, EQA, Alerts, Storage, Batch Entry, Barcode) plus DEEP interaction suites, cross-module Chains, role Personas, dashboard reconciliation, security (CSRF/XSS/SQLi), and WCAG checks. Runs interactively via Claude in Chrome and/or via a Playwright harness. Use whenever the user wants to QA-test, regression-test, smoke-test, or audit an OpenELIS Global instance, or file QA bug tickets.

analyzer-mapping-spec
Développeurs de logiciels

Build OpenELIS Global analyzer integration specifications. Use this skill whenever a user mentions an analyzer, instrument, LIS integration, ASTM, HL7, MLLP, CSV flat file, or anything related to connecting laboratory equipment to OpenELIS. Always trigger this skill when asked to write a spec, mapping doc, integration spec, companion guide, or Jira story for any lab analyzer or instrument. Also trigger when the user wants to update the Analyzer Integration Tracker on Confluence. This skill covers the full workflow: instrument classification, protocol identification, spec authoring, companion setup guide, Jira story creation, and Confluence tracker update. Protocol/field-mapping is owned here; analyzer UI design defers to the openelis-design skill.
